Austell: frequently asked questions

Is Austell's water safe to drink?

Austell is an active community water system regulated under the Safe Drinking Water Act, overseen by the GA state drinking water program. EPA SDWA violation and enforcement records for this system are being added to AquaCensus from EPA ECHO; consult EPA ECHO or your annual Consumer Confidence Report for its current compliance status.

Who runs Austell?

Austell (PWSID GA0670001) is a local government-owned community water system, regulated by the GA state drinking water program.

How many people does Austell serve?

Austell reports serving 7,774 people through 2,990 service connections in Cobb County, Georgia.

Where does Austell get its water?

EPA SDWIS lists this system's primary water source as purchased surface water.
